Today, the European Parliament delivered a significant victory for environmental protection and public health by siding with nature and formally supporting the proposed restriction on lead in fishing tackle. This pivotal decision, which saw the rejection of a baseless objection, paves the way for the measure to enter into force within the coming weeks. The vote signals a robust political commitment within the European Union to mitigate the pervasive threat of lead pollution, although critical loopholes remain that will require further action from individual Member States.

The Peril of Lead: A Silent Killer in Aquatic Ecosystems

Lead has long been recognized as a highly toxic heavy metal with devastating effects on both wildlife and human health. Its insidious nature lies in its persistence in the environment and its ability to bioaccumulate and biomagnify through food chains. When lead fishing tackle is lost or discarded in aquatic environments, it introduces a potent poison into delicate ecosystems. Fish, amphibians, and invertebrates can absorb lead directly from the water or sediment, leading to chronic poisoning, impaired reproduction, and behavioral changes.

However, the most visible and tragic victims of lead fishing tackle are often waterfowl and birds of prey. Ducks, swans, geese, and other waterbirds frequently ingest lead sinkers and weights, mistaking them for grit or food. Once ingested, the lead slowly dissolves in the bird’s gizzard, releasing toxic lead salts into the bloodstream. This leads to a debilitating condition known as lead poisoning, characterized by lethargy, emaciation, neurological damage, paralysis, and ultimately, death. Studies have shown that even a single lead shot or sinker can be lethal to a swan. Raptors, such as eagles and ospreys, are also vulnerable through secondary poisoning when they prey on lead-contaminated waterfowl or scavenge carcasses of animals that have ingested lead. This ripple effect underscores the far-reaching consequences of lead pollution from seemingly innocuous sources. For humans, exposure to lead, even at low levels, can cause severe health problems, including neurological damage, developmental issues in children, cardiovascular disease, and reproductive problems. The European Chemicals Agency (ECHA) and numerous health organizations have consistently highlighted these risks, advocating for stringent controls on lead use.

Scale of the Problem: Quantifying Lead Release

The sheer volume of lead released into the environment annually through fishing activities is staggering. Estimates indicate that approximately 4,800 tonnes of lead find their way into Europe’s rivers, lakes, and coastal waters each year from lost or discarded fishing tackle. This figure highlights the pervasive nature of the problem and the cumulative impact of individual angling activities across the continent. This quantity represents a significant input of a highly toxic substance into sensitive habitats, posing a continuous threat to biodiversity and ecosystem health. The fragmentation of lead into smaller particles over time also makes remediation efforts incredibly challenging, emphasizing the need for preventative measures at the source.

Details of the New Restriction: Scope and Transition

The adopted restriction represents a significant step forward, targeting the sale and use of lead fishing tackle in specific categories. The measure will ban the sale of lead fishing tackle weighing below 1kg. This threshold aims to capture the vast majority of sinkers, weights, and lures commonly used in various forms of angling. To facilitate a smooth transition for manufacturers, retailers, and anglers, the restriction includes phased implementation with transition periods ranging from 6 months to 5 years, depending on the specific type of gear. This allows time for the industry to adapt production lines, clear existing stock, and for consumers to shift to alternative materials. Crucially, the restriction will also extend to a ban on the use of these specific lead fishing weights in commercial fishing operations. While commercial fishing might contribute less to the total volume of lost tackle compared to recreational fishing, its inclusion ensures a comprehensive approach to reducing lead inputs from professional maritime and inland activities.

The Recreational Fishing Loophole: A Critical Concern

Despite these welcome advancements, a significant limitation within the adopted proposal has drawn concern from environmental advocates: it does not ban the use of lead in recreational fishing. This critical loophole means that most of the lead fishing products already on the market and in the possession of recreational anglers can still be used in the future. Given that recreational fishing is widely recognized as the primary source of lead pollution from angling, this exemption could substantially undermine the overall effectiveness of the restriction.

The practical implications of this loophole are profound. Existing stocks of lead tackle, accumulated over years by millions of recreational anglers across Europe, will continue to contribute to environmental contamination for an indefinite period. This poses a direct and ongoing risk to wildlife and human health, particularly in popular angling spots. Environmental organizations and experts are now urging Member States to go beyond the adopted EU restriction. They emphasize that national governments must take proactive steps to close this gap by implementing comprehensive bans on the use of lead for recreational fishing within their respective territories. Such national-level interventions would align with the spirit of the EU’s decision and ensure a more complete and immediate cessation of lead pollution from this sector.

Expert Commentary and Advocacy

Marion Bessol, Nature Conservation Policy Officer, articulated the sentiment of environmental organizations following the vote. "MEPs saw through a baseless attempt to derail this restriction and listened to the facts. That matters, because we’re talking about 4,800 tonnes of lead entering our environment every year, a well-documented poison that is toxic for humans and wildlife alike." Her statement underscores the importance of the Parliament’s decision to prioritize scientific evidence. However, Bessol also highlighted the critical remaining challenge: "But this vote is only half the job. As it stands, the recreational fishing loophole means most lead tackle already on shelves can keep being used, so Member States now have to close that gap nationally. And with the lead ammunition restriction soon heading to Parliament for scrutiny, MEPs have already shown us they know how to tell real science from political noise." This strong call to action from BirdLife Europe emphasizes the ongoing need for vigilance and further legislative steps to achieve a truly lead-free environment.

The Search for Sustainable Alternatives: Innovation in Angling

The move away from lead in fishing tackle is not a novel concept, and the industry has already seen significant innovation in developing sustainable alternatives. A variety of lead-free materials are available, offering comparable performance to traditional lead weights without the environmental cost. Common alternatives include:

  • Steel: Durable and readily available, steel weights are a cost-effective and environmentally friendly option. They are denser than lead, requiring a slightly larger size for the same weight, but their performance is generally excellent.
  • Bismuth: A heavy metal that is significantly less toxic than lead, bismuth is increasingly popular for its density and casting properties, closely mimicking lead.
  • Tungsten: Known for its high density, tungsten allows for smaller, more compact weights, which can be advantageous in certain fishing techniques. However, it is typically more expensive than other alternatives.
  • Tin: Lighter than lead, tin weights are a good option for applications where less density is acceptable. They are environmentally benign and widely available.
  • Brass and other alloys: Various non-toxic alloys are also being explored and adopted by manufacturers, offering a range of densities and properties to suit different angling needs.

The availability of these alternatives directly refutes claims made by the PfE Group regarding a lack of viable substitutes. Many manufacturers have already begun producing and marketing these lead-free options, and their market share is expected to grow significantly with the new EU restrictions. While some alternatives might come with a slightly higher price point or require minor adjustments in angling technique, the long-term environmental and health benefits far outweigh these considerations. Educational campaigns and incentives can further accelerate the adoption of these sustainable options among the angling community.

A Broader Context: The History of Lead Bans

The restriction on lead in fishing tackle is not an isolated event but rather a continuation of a broader historical trend of progressively phasing out lead from various consumer products and industrial applications due to its documented toxicity. Landmark decisions over the past decades include:

  • Lead in Paint: Banned in most developed countries since the 1970s and 80s due to risks, especially to children.
  • Lead in Gasoline: Phased out globally, significantly reducing atmospheric lead pollution and associated public health impacts. The EU completed its phase-out by 2000.
  • Lead in Plumbing: Restrictions on lead pipes and solder in drinking water systems have been in place for decades to prevent water contamination.
  • Lead in Toys: Strict regulations limit lead content in children’s toys to protect against ingestion risks.
  • Lead in Electronics (RoHS Directive): The EU’s Restriction of Hazardous Substances (RoHS) Directive largely bans lead in electrical and electronic equipment, promoting safer manufacturing and recycling.

This consistent pattern of regulatory action demonstrates a clear and evolving understanding of lead’s dangers and a commitment to protecting public health and the environment. The current decision on fishing tackle aligns perfectly with this historical trajectory, further solidifying Europe’s position as a leader in environmental policy. It also sets a precedent for future discussions on other pervasive sources of lead pollution.

Looking Ahead: The Ammunition Debate

The European Parliament’s firm stance on lead in fishing tackle sets a crucial precedent for another contentious environmental issue: the restriction of lead ammunition. As Marion Bessol noted, the lead ammunition restriction is "soon heading to Parliament for scrutiny." Lead ammunition, particularly shotgun pellets, poses similar threats to wildlife, especially waterfowl that ingest spent shot and raptors that feed on animals shot with lead. The debate surrounding ammunition is often more complex, involving hunting traditions, safety concerns, and economic factors for ammunition manufacturers. However, the Parliament’s recent demonstration of prioritizing scientific evidence over objections suggests a strong likelihood of further action on lead ammunition, building on the momentum generated by the fishing tackle decision. This holistic approach to phasing out lead from outdoor activities is essential for achieving a truly sustainable and healthy environment across Europe.
